S121-E-05902 (7 July 2006) --- Astronaut Stephanie D. Wilson (center), STS-121 mission specialist, works with the Mobile Service System (MSS) and Canadarm2 controls in the Destiny laboratory of the International Space Station while Space Shuttle Discovery was docked to the station.
